Key points to keep in mind before applying

To apply for an EPSO Competition, you must:

  • use an email address to create an EU Login Account
  • create an EU Login Account to login to the Single Candidate Portal
  • create a profile in the Single Candidate Portal (SCP)

 

If you expect any changes in your contractual status within the next 18 months, it is very important that you use the correct email address.

Such changes may include, for example:

  • expiration of contract (for Contract or Temporary Agents)
  • unpaid leave (CCP)
  • change of institution
  • any other changes affecting the access to your EU email address

 

Why this is important

EPSO competitions typically take several months before final results are published. If in the meantime your contractual status changes, and your EU email address becomes inactive, you will no longer receive EPSO notifications, including the competition results.

To avoid this risk, we strongly recommend that you:

  • use a private email address (ie Gmail, Yahoo, Outlook)
  • do not use your EU Login Account linked to your EU email address (ending in .europa.eu),  which you use to log in EU systems (ie Sysper)

If necessary, create a new EU Login Account using your private email address, and use it to:

  • create your profile in the Single Candidate Portal
  • apply for the EPSO competition
